Transaction 134e87dee8e9ef45b17978732a9e89eea6e7ae2d15821dadd9766f324b3fe0d6
1 Input
1 Output
-
134e87dee8e9ef45b17978732a9e89eea6e7ae2d15821dadd9766f324b3fe0d6:0
- value
- 21354767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df1743510ca9a4add1771525ad987e2ebc6dfc14 OP_EQUAL
- address
- 3N2cUfFuS4AvKeXjseDoVoFKaRYMhXtKhb